在线支付网站全流程解析,从概念到实现之路

在线支付网站全流程解析,从概念到实现之路

admin 2024-12-05 教育系统 608 次浏览 0个评论
摘要:,,本文将对在线支付网站的全流程进行解析,从概念到实现。文章首先介绍在线支付网站的基本概念及其在现代社会的重要性。阐述网站的需求分析和规划阶段,包括目标用户群体的定位、功能需求及商业模式的设计。文章将详细介绍技术实现过程,包括前后端技术选型、支付接口的开发与集成、数据安全和用户体验的优化等关键环节。文章将总结整个开发流程的关键步骤和注意事项,为有意进入在线支付领域的读者提供有价值的参考。

本文目录导读:

  1. 需求分析
  2. 设计
  3. 开发
  4. 测试与优化
  5. 上线与推广
  6. 运营与维护

随着互联网技术的飞速发展和电子商务的崛起,在线支付已成为日常生活中不可或缺的一部分,在线支付网站作为连接消费者与商家的桥梁,其重要性日益凸显,本文将详细介绍如何构建一个在线支付网站,从需求分析、设计、开发到测试上线,全方位解析这一过程的各个环节。

需求分析

1、目标用户群体

在构建在线支付网站之前,首先要明确目标用户群体,您是面向个人用户还是企业用户?您的用户来自哪些行业?他们的支付习惯和需求是什么?这些问题的答案将有助于确定网站的功能和设计。

2、竞争对手分析

对市场上的竞争对手进行深入分析,了解他们的优势和劣势,借鉴他们的成功经验,找出自己网站的创新点,以吸引更多用户。

3、功能需求

根据目标用户群体和竞争对手分析,确定网站的基本功能,如账户注册、登录、转账、支付、收款、账单查询等,还需考虑是否支持多种支付方式(如支付宝、微信支付、银行卡支付等)。

设计

1、网站架构

选择一个稳定、安全的网站架构,确保用户信息的安全性和网站的正常运行,采用分层设计,将业务逻辑与具体实现分离,以便于后期的维护和扩展。

2、界面设计

设计简洁、直观的界面,使用户能够轻松找到所需功能,注重用户体验,确保网站的易用性和响应速度。

在线支付网站全流程解析,从概念到实现之路

3、安全性设计

支付网站涉及用户的财产安全,因此安全性设计至关重要,采用加密技术保护用户信息,设置多重身份验证,防范黑客攻击。

开发

1、技术选型

根据需求分析和设计,选择合适的技术栈,前端可采用HTML5、CSS3、JavaScript等技术,后端可采用Java、Python、PHP等语言,数据库可选用MySQL、Oracle、MongoDB等。

2、搭建开发环境

根据选定的技术栈,搭建开发环境,配置服务器、购买域名、安装必要的软件和工具等。

3、编码与测试

开始编码,实现网站的各项功能,在开发过程中,注重代码的可读性和可维护性,完成编码后,进行严格的测试,确保网站的功能和性能达到预期要求。

测试与优化

1、功能测试

在线支付网站全流程解析,从概念到实现之路

对网站的各项功能进行全面测试,确保用户能够正常使用,测试注册、登录、支付、转账等功能是否正常,是否会出现错误或延迟。

2、性能测试

模拟真实用户环境,对网站的并发处理能力、响应速度等进行测试,确保网站在高并发情况下仍能稳定运行。

3、安全性测试

请专业机构对网站进行安全性测试,检查是否存在安全漏洞,根据测试结果,对网站进行优化和改进。

上线与推广

1、部署上线

将网站部署到服务器上,完成域名解析,使网站能够对外访问。

2、宣传推广

通过社交媒体、广告、合作伙伴等途径,对网站进行宣传推广,吸引更多用户。

在线支付网站全流程解析,从概念到实现之路

运营与维护

1、数据分析与优化

收集用户数据,分析用户行为和使用习惯,优化网站功能和界面设计,提高用户体验。

2、安全防护

时刻关注网站安全状况,及时更新安全策略,防范黑客攻击和病毒威胁。

3、客户服务与技术支持

为用户提供良好的客户服务和技术支持,解决用户在使用过程中遇到的问题,关注用户反馈,不断改进和优化网站功能。

转载请注明来自小黄狮-建站,本文标题:《在线支付网站全流程解析,从概念到实现之路》

百度分享代码,如果开启HTTPS请参考李洋个人博客
每一天,每一秒,你所做的决定都会改变你的人生!
Top